Procedure generated via AI
Heat oil in a pot and add chopped onion. Cook until it turns golden brown and caramelizes.
Add one pound of ground beef and cook until fully browned with no pink remaining.
Stir in the entire packet of taco seasoning until well combined.
After five minutes, add a 14-ounce can of diced tomatoes and simmer for about five minutes until the sauce thickens.
Reduce the heat to low and let the mixture simmer gently for 30 to 40 minutes.
Meanwhile, dice fresh tomatoes into small pieces using a tomato scraper or knife.
Finely chop the red onion by slicing it lengthwise and crosswise, then mincing into small bits.
Store the chopped vegetables in the refrigerator while the meat simmers.
Warm the taco shells in the toaster oven, watching carefully to prevent burning, until they reach the desired crispiness.
Once the meat is ready, spoon the taco beef mixture into each shell. Top with lettuce, avocado, diced tomatoes, and your favorite salsa.
